Bob's Suzuki X-90 page

This page is dedicated to my Suzuki X-90... and to all Suzuki X-90s. The unique little two-seater was manufactured by the Suzuki Motors Corp from 1996 through 1998. Only 7,204 were sold in the United States. Like a truck, it is built on a ladder frame and shares its mechanicals with the Suzuki Sidekick. But its three-box design, lack of a rear seat, and open-air driving are design elements of a traditional roadster. You might say it is something of a cross between an SUV and a roadster.
